Curing Skin Cancer
Surgery: The primary treatment of all stages, surgery is aimed at removing the tumor.
Chemotherapy: This therapy is used to either kill the cancer cells or to stop them from dividing through the use of drugs.
Radiation therapy: It is the use of high-energy x-rays and radiation to kill cancer cells or stop them from growing.
Biologic therapy: In this therapy, the patient’s immune system is used to fight cancer. Substances from the body are developed in a laboratory to boost, or restore natural defenses of the body to fight vcancer.
Targeted therapy: In this therapy, drugs or other substances are used to attack cancer cells.
